Definition

Tuberculosis (TB) is a contagious bacterial infection caused by Mycobacterium tuberculosis, primarily affecting the lungs but can also impact other parts of the body. The emergence of specialized scientific disciplines in medicine and microbiology has highlighted the need for accurate scientific illustrations to depict TB's symptoms, transmission routes, and the development of treatment protocols.

5 Must Know Facts For Your Next Test

  1. Tuberculosis was a leading cause of death in the 19th century, prompting significant advancements in public health and the establishment of specialized medical fields.
  2. Scientific illustrations played a crucial role in understanding tuberculosis, showcasing how it spreads and the visible symptoms such as lesions in the lungs seen in X-rays.
  3. The disease can be latent, meaning people can carry the bacteria without showing symptoms but can develop active TB later, contributing to its spread.
  4. Efforts to combat TB have included improvements in sanitation and nutrition, as well as advancements in diagnostic techniques and antibiotic treatments.
  5. The resurgence of tuberculosis in some areas has highlighted the importance of continued research and innovation in public health strategies and scientific illustration.
